Kevin Hart thanks family for ‘stepping up to the plate’ in first public appearance since car crash

Kevin Hart was met with a standing ovation as he made his first public appearance since being left critically injured in a horror car crash.

The Hollywood actor, 40, was honoured at the People’s Choice Awards on Sunday night, accepting the best Comedy Act accolade for his Netflix special, Irresponsible.

Speaking on stage at the Santa Monica event, Hart said: “First and foremost, thank God, because I definitely don’t have to be here.

“Being that I am, it makes me appreciate life even more. It makes me appreciate the things that really matter – family.

Hart's emotional speech won praise from fans

“I want to think my wife and kids, who really stepped up to the plate for me," he continued.

Hart was a passenger in a vintage muscle car when the driver lost control, sped down an embankment and slammed into a tree near Malibu in September.

He suffered major back injuries in the crash and in an emotional video shared last month, he detailed his recovery process.

“After my accident I see things differently, I see life from a whole new perspective,” he said in the video. “My appreciation for life is through the roof. I’m thankful for my family, my friends.

“Don’t take today for granted because tomorrow’s not promised. More importantly I’m thankful for God, I’m thankful for life. I’m thankful for simply still being here.”

The footage showed Hart laying in a hospital bed, being assisted by nurses and using a walking frame to stand up.
